Ticket: Websocket reconnect storm traced to config drift

The Larkspur gateway reconnect bug only reproduces on hosts where the deployed config diverged from what's in the repo. Two nodes had a stale backoff ceiling, causing clients to hammer reconnects. The fix PR restores the canonical values everywhere. For review, the intended configuration on all gateway nodes is the following.

deployment values, bagag-bawig:
DRUVAN_PIN=0740
DRUVAN_TENANT=wendor
DRUVAN_METRICS_HOST=metrics.druvan.tolvaqnet.example
DRUVAN_SEAL=seal_75cd0b2d
DRUVAN_STANDBY_TEAM=tamael

Action item from the Brellix kiosk outage (PM-44): the watchdog on KioskShell v3 silently stopped restarting the UI process after three crashes, leaving units at the Varnholt depot blank overnight. Fix shipped in 3.2.1: watchdog now escalates to a full device reboot after the third failed restart and logs each attempt. Support: if a kiosk shows a black screen but responds to ping, it's likely pre-3.2.1. Verify firmware version before dispatching a tech. Full triage steps are on the internal page below.

dashboard of kafof-tahaf = https://confluence.tolvaqsys.internal/projects/browse/display/a1250987

## Build Provenance — Ormskift Refactor

The legacy Quarrel ORM layer in the Tollgate service is being replaced module-by-module with Ledgerline mappers. Each migrated module must be built via the provenance pipeline so artifact lineage stays auditable. Do not approve merges that bypass the signed builder image. Schema diffs are generated at build time and attached to the artifact manifest; review them before sign-off. The refactor branch builds reproducibly on the Harrowfen runners. The provenance token for the current candidate build is:

trace token, kawip-fafog: htk14_26e64c4d35154e